webextension: provide unpacked extensions when building
This commit is contained in:
parent
6ee0354940
commit
ced02d1fed
@ -4,7 +4,3 @@ set -e
|
||||
[ "also-wallet" == "$1" ] && { pnpm -C ../taler-wallet-core/ compile || exit 1; }
|
||||
[ "also-util" == "$1" ] && { pnpm -C ../taler-util/ prepare || exit 1; }
|
||||
pnpm clean && pnpm compile && rm -rf extension/ && ./pack.sh
|
||||
(cd extension/v2 && unzip taler*.zip)
|
||||
(cd extension/v3 && unzip taler*.zip)
|
||||
|
||||
|
||||
|
@ -7,7 +7,5 @@ rm -rf dist lib tsconfig.tsbuildinfo
|
||||
(cd ../.. && rm -rf build/web && ./contrib/build-fast-web.sh)
|
||||
rm -rf extension/
|
||||
./pack.sh
|
||||
(cd extension/v2 && unzip taler*.zip)
|
||||
(cd extension/v3 && unzip taler*.zip)
|
||||
|
||||
mv node_modules{_saved,}
|
||||
|
@ -19,6 +19,10 @@ cp -r dist static $TEMP_DIR
|
||||
mkdir -p extension/v2
|
||||
mv "$TEMP_DIR/$zipfile" ./extension/v2/
|
||||
rm -rf $TEMP_DIR
|
||||
# also provide unpacked version
|
||||
rm -rf extension/v2/unpacked
|
||||
mkdir -p extension/v2/unpacked
|
||||
(cd extension/v2/unpacked && unzip ../$zipfile)
|
||||
echo "Packed webextension: extension/v2/$zipfile"
|
||||
|
||||
|
||||
@ -33,4 +37,8 @@ cp -r dist static $TEMP_DIR
|
||||
mkdir -p extension/v3
|
||||
mv "$TEMP_DIR/$zipfile" ./extension/v3/
|
||||
rm -rf $TEMP_DIR
|
||||
# also provide unpacked version
|
||||
rm -rf extension/v3/unpacked
|
||||
mkdir -p extension/v3/unpacked
|
||||
(cd extension/v3/unpacked && unzip ../$zipfile)
|
||||
echo "Packed webextension: extension/v3/$zipfile"
|
||||
|
Loading…
Reference in New Issue
Block a user